A signed Limited Edition Print of the original artwork 'Eyes on the Prize' by Laura Richards.

A wonderful autumn print, featuring a British Roe Deer.

Inspired by Victorian natural history collections  and a love of the British countryside, Laura creates highly detailed hand-drawn pencil illustrations of British Wildlife. This classic print will add a touch of nostalgia and elegance to your home.

Prints are supplied mounted.

Print taken from pencil and ink original illustrations and printed onto high quality 300gsm paper using archival inks which are guaranteed to keep your print vibrant and wont fade for up to 100years.
Due to the natural imperfections of the paper some  tiny flecks or texture may be seen and is normal.

Limited Edition of 250 prints only.

All prints are carefully hand signed and numbered by the artist then packaged in a protective bio-degradable cellophane wrap and posted flat in a board backed envelope.


Printed in Britian

Print size : 29cm x 21cm (approx.)
mount size: 40cm x 30cm (approx.)
